Introduction to Reverse Mortgages

Reverse mortgages offer a valuable financial tool for seniors aged 62 and older in Fresno County, California, allowing them to convert a portion of their home equity into cash without the need to sell their home or make monthly mortgage payments, as long as they continue to live in the property as their primary residence. This option is particularly beneficial for retirees looking to enhance their financial stability.

Key features of reverse mortgages include the absence of required monthly payments, which can provide peace of mind and flexibility. Funds from these loans can be accessed in various ways, helping to supplement retirement income, cover essential healthcare costs, or finance important home improvements to maintain a comfortable living environment.

Eligibility and Requirements

To qualify for reverse mortgage loans offered by Summit Lending, individuals must meet specific criteria designed to ensure they can benefit from these financial options. First, you must be at least 62 years old, as this is the minimum age requirement for most reverse mortgage programs. For more details on our reverse loans, visit our reverse loans page.

In terms of homeownership status, you need to own your home outright or have a low mortgage balance that can be paid off with the reverse mortgage proceeds. Eligible property types include single-family homes, 2-4 unit properties where you occupy one unit, FHA-approved condos, or manufactured homes. One key requirement is that the home must be your primary residence. Additionally, you must maintain the property in good condition and continue to pay for taxes, insurance, and any necessary upkeep. All borrowers are required to complete HUD-approved counseling to fully understand the implications of a reverse mortgage. How Reverse Mortgages Work

Reverse mortgages are financial tools designed for homeowners aged 62 and older, allowing them to access their home equity without the need for monthly loan payments. In Fresno County, California, these loans can provide essential funds for retirement needs. At Summit Lending, our experts are here to guide you through the process.

Disbursement Options: Funds from a reverse mortgage can be disbursed in flexible ways to suit your financial situation. You might receive a lump sum for immediate needs, a line of credit for ongoing access, or monthly payments for steady income. Factors Affecting Loan Amount: The amount you can borrow is influenced by several key factors, including the appraised value of your home, prevailing interest rates, and your age—the older you are, the more you may qualify for. Repayment Scenarios: Repayment of a reverse mortgage is not required until certain events occur, such as when you permanently move out of the home, sell the property, or pass away. Benefits and Considerations

Reverse mortgage loans can offer significant advantages for seniors in Fresno County, California, particularly by providing increased cash flow for retirees. This allows you to access your home equity as tax-free funds, which can be used for daily expenses, healthcare, or home improvements, helping you maintain your lifestyle without monthly loan payments. Additionally, these loans enable you to age in place comfortably in your own home.

However, there are important factors to weigh before proceeding. Impacts on heirs may include a reduced inheritance, as the loan balance grows over time and must be repaid when the home is sold or no longer your primary residence. Fees involved, such as closing costs and mortgage insurance premiums, can add up, so it’s essential to review these details carefully. Tax implications are generally favorable since the funds are tax-free, but they could affect eligibility for certain government benefits if not managed properly.
